What is a bedside bassinet for the c section? A bedside bassinet for c section is a piece of furniture that can be used for post-operative mothers who have just had a Cesarean section. This type of bassinet attaches to the side of the mother’s bed and provides a comfortable place for the baby to sleep. It can also be helpful in encouraging early breastfeeding.

Safety First
When it comes to baby gear, safety is always a top priority. Make sure the bassinet you choose has been certified by a recognized safety organization, like the Juvenile Products Manufacturers Association (JPMA). Also look for features like a stable base and a firm, flat sleeping surface.

Are bedside bassinets safe?
Bedside bassinets are safe if used as directed. They should only be used for infants who are not yet able to roll over and should never be used for infants who can rollover. A bedside bassinet should also never be placed near a window, door, or radiator.
How long can you use a bedside bassinet?
A bedside bassinet is meant to be used until the baby can roll onto its side. The average age for this is around 4 months.
